The admissions information below is valid for the 2023 academic year.

FIRST-TIME FRESHMAN APPLICATION PROCESS & REQUIREMENTS
Is there an application deadline for fall? yes
Final filing date for fall: July 23
Application fee: $100
High school graduation is: required, GED is accepted
Standardized test requirements: SAT I or ACT required
Dates test scores should be received: July 30 for SAT I/ACT, July 30 for SAT II
School has formalized early decision program: no
School has early action program: no
School has concurrent enrollment program for high school: no

FIRST-TIME FRESHMAN SELECTION PROCESS
Academic criteria:
  • secondary school report not considered
  • class rank not considered
  • standardized test scores very important
Average secondary school GPA: 2.95
Percent of freshmen who submitted GPA: 80%
Percent of freshmen who submitted class rank: 40%
Average SAT I: 533 verbal, 510 math
Combined SAT I middle 50% range: 870 - 1130
Percent of accepted applicants who submitted SAT I scores: 4%

FIRST-TIME FRESHMAN ENROLLMENT
Number of completed applications received: 8
Number of applicants offered admission who enrolled: 7
School has a waiting list policy: no
Percent of freshmen who came from out of state: 4%
Admission may be deferred: yes
